Some do it for the quiet, the freedom, the leisurely pedal. Others do it for the thrills, the speed, the jumps and drops. Cycling is one of the most popular activities in the Forest of Dean and Wye Valley, with opportunities for both novice and experienced mountain bikers, families and adrenaline junkies. So why not bring your own bikes and make the most of our scenic trails, great facilities and cycle friendly accommodation. From luxury hotels to cosy cottages, log cabins to B&Bs, our area welcomes cyclists of all kinds and our accommodation providers often go the extra mile to ensure your precious cycles are super safe for your stay. So why not bring the bikes and have a cycling break in the glorious Forest of Dean and Wye Valley? Explore all of our accommodation which has secure cycle storage on site below.
You can also book a guided ride, go downhill, bring the family, get your friends together or just come on your own and enjoy our many miles of cycle trails here in the Forest of Dean and Wye Valley. If you need to you can also hire bikes and equipment from several locations including bikes with trailers, e-bikes, full suspension, trikes, tandems and kids bikes plus there are uplift services too.
